Travelling on time tracks

Sicilian heritage trains.
More than 50 tours travelling on board vintage carriages to the most charming and evocative spots in Sicily. And you can also bring your bike along!

ph. Fondazione FS – Alessio Cecconi

The heritage trains are travelling back across the island’s most stunning and scenic railway lines.
Until the 10th of December, an extensive calendar of itineraries takes you on an exploration of a territory packed with historical and architectural wonders and unique flavours, connecting cities of art and places that are the guardians of breathtaking landscapes and witnesses of a millenary history.
Each heritage train itinerary allows you to visit beautiful destinations, in some stages even accompanied by qualified guides who will unveil the secrets of many wonders. And, alongside the Centoporte carriages from the 1930s and Corbellini carriages from the 1950s, you will have access to a compartment equipped to accommodate your bicycle free of charge.

*Tickets are € 2.00 for adults and € 1.00 for children. They can be purchased through Trenitalia sales channels, on the Fondazione FS website or directly on board, providing seats are available.
Access to visited cultural heritage sites are to be paid by travellers.

All timetables and further information are available on the website fondazionefs.it – e-mail trenistorici@fondazionefs.it
The operation is supported and promoted by the Regione Siciliana (Sicily Region) through the Assessorato del Turismo, dello Sport e dello Spettacolo (Department of Tourism, Sport and Entertainment), in collaboration with the Fondazione FS (Italian Railway Heritage Trust).

16th of September
Train of the Temples
Touristic train from Caltanissetta to Agrigento Bassa and Porto Empedocle Succursale
Leaving at
14:18 16:03
Back by
21:00 22:46
Hop aboard our tourist train and let us take you on a journey to discover Agrigento's fascinating Valley of the Temples, before moving on to a splendid Mediterranean landscape, the cradle of the great Italian literature, passing the birthplace of Luigi Pirandello and reaching, at the last stop, the seaside village where Andrea Camilleri was born.
Along the way, you can hop off and visit the Valley of the Temples and the Garden of the Kolymbethra: from the train stop, in the heart of Agrigento's archaeological park, you can stroll to the Giardino (the Garden), a legendary place 2,500 years old with the scent of citrus fruits and pomegranates still irrigated by the ancient water network, accompanied by an official guide from the Regione Siciliana who will disclose all its secrets, giving you an unmatched experience (services included in the cost of the ticket).

Entrance tickets to the Garden of Kolymbethra and the Archaeological Park of Agrigento are to be paid by travellers; the ticket to the Archaeological Park should be purchased online, while the ticket for the Giardino (Garden) can be purchased on arrival at a special reduced cost reserved for the travellers on Sicily's heritage trains.
